What Is Cold Laser Therapy?



Cold laser treatment, additionally called low-level laser treatment (LLLT), is a non-invasive treatment that utilizes certain wavelengths of light to promote healing and decrease pain.

This ingenious approach targets harmed tissues, stimulating cellular task without triggering damage or pain. You might discover it advantageous for numerous problems, consisting of joint discomfort, muscular tissue injuries, and swelling.

Unlike traditional laser therapies, cold laser therapy doesn't produce warmth, making it secure and comfy for clients. Therapies usually last in between 5 to half an hour, depending on the location being addressed.

You could obtain several sessions for ideal outcomes, and many people report feeling alleviation after simply a couple of therapies.

Cold laser therapy provides an appealing choice for those seeking efficient discomfort monitoring.

Session Duration and Frequency



Most cold laser therapy sessions last in between 15 to 30 minutes, depending on the particular therapy area and your private requirements.

Throughout your session, the specialist will certainly place the laser tool over the targeted location, allowing it to emit light that penetrates the skin.

You could need numerous sessions for ideal outcomes, typically ranging from 2 to 3 times weekly.

Security and Negative Effects of Cold Laser Treatment



While cold laser treatment is generally considered secure, it's vital to recognize possible side effects. Most individuals experience minimal discomfort, yet you may notice momentary skin irritability or a sensation of heat during treatment.

Rarely, some people report headaches or dizziness after sessions. If you're sensitive to light or have specific clinical problems, discuss this with your healthcare provider before beginning treatment.

Likewise, make certain the practitioner is qualified and uses FDA-approved devices. Although serious side effects are uncommon, it's important to monitor your body's response after each session.

If you experience any uncommon signs, do not think twice to reach out to your doctor for support. Being notified helps make sure a positive experience with cold laser therapy.
